I'm guessing the microphone is not great. A lot of times, they make these look like a traditional large diaphragm condenser mic, but it's just a tiny dynamic mic inside the nice shell.

On the other hand, $22 is not a bad price for the desk mounted scissor arm stand and pop filter.

I'd suggest going with a USB Blue or Samson mic. Behringer probably has something good. Under $50 or better with a good sale.
